Gemini Deep Research is an agentic research tool built into Google's Gemini Advanced. It autonomously browses the web, reads multiple sources, and synthesizes findings into structured, citation-backed reports.
How It Works
- You provide a research question or topic
- Gemini creates a research plan with subtopics
- You review and modify the plan
- The agent browses dozens of web sources autonomously
- It synthesizes findings into a comprehensive report
- You receive a structured document with citations
What Makes It Different
| Feature | Deep Research | Standard Gemini | Perplexity | |---|---|---|---| | Sources consulted | 50-100+ | 5-10 | 10-20 | | Autonomous browsing | Yes | Limited | Limited | | Report length | 2,000-5,000 words | 500-1,000 words | 500-1,500 words | | Research plan | Editable before execution | None | None | | Execution time | 2-10 minutes | Seconds | Seconds | | Export options | Google Docs | Copy/paste | Copy/paste |
Access Requirements
- Google One AI Premium plan or Gemini Advanced subscription
- Available in Gemini web app (gemini.google.com)
- Select "Deep Research" from the model picker
- Currently supports English language queries best
